停止所有爬虫容器,搭建蜘蛛池教程图解视频大全
停止所有爬虫容器并搭建蜘蛛池是一个涉及技术操作的过程,通常用于网络爬虫的管理和优化,为了更直观地指导用户完成这一任务,网络上提供了丰富的教程图解视频资源,这些视频教程通过详细的步骤和清晰的图示,帮助用户了解如何停止现有的爬虫容器,并搭建一个高效的蜘蛛池,这些教程内容全面,包括技术细节、注意事项以及常见问题解答,非常适合技术爱好者和专业人士学习和参考,通过这类教程,用户可以提升爬虫管理的效率,优化网络爬虫的性能。
搭建蜘蛛池教程图解视频
在数字营销和SEO(搜索引擎优化)领域,蜘蛛池(Spider Farm)是一种用于模拟搜索引擎爬虫行为的技术,它可以帮助网站管理员和SEO专家更好地理解搜索引擎如何抓取和索引网站内容,本文将详细介绍如何搭建一个蜘蛛池,并提供相应的图解视频教程,帮助读者轻松上手。
什么是蜘蛛池
蜘蛛池是一种模拟搜索引擎爬虫行为的工具,通过模拟多个搜索引擎爬虫对网站进行访问和抓取,可以获取详细的网站数据,包括页面结构、链接关系、内容质量等,这些信息对于优化网站SEO、提高搜索引擎排名非常有帮助。
搭建蜘蛛池的步骤
准备环境
需要准备一台服务器或虚拟机,并安装相应的操作系统(如Ubuntu、CentOS等),确保服务器上已安装Python、Docker等必要的软件。
安装Docker
Docker是一个开源的容器化平台,用于简化应用部署和运维,以下是安装Docker的步骤:
-
Ubuntu:
sudo apt-get update sudo apt-get install -y docker.io sudo systemctl enable docker sudo systemctl start docker
-
CentOS:
sudo yum install -y yum-utils device-mapper-persistent-data lvm2 sudo yum-config-manager --add-repo https://download.docker.com/linux/centos/docker-ce.repo sudo yum install -y docker-ce docker-ce-cli containerd.io sudo systemctl start docker sudo systemctl enable docker
创建Docker网络
为了隔离不同爬虫容器之间的网络,需要创建一个Docker网络:
docker network create spider_farm_net
下载并配置Spider Pool镜像
这里假设已经有一个Spider Pool的Docker镜像(如spiderpool:latest
),可以从Docker Hub或其他私有仓库下载,如果没有现成的镜像,可以基于开源的爬虫框架(如Scrapy、Selenium等)自行构建镜像。
docker pull spiderpool:latest
启动爬虫容器
使用Docker运行多个爬虫容器,每个容器代表一个“蜘蛛”,可以通过docker run
命令启动多个实例:
for i in {1..10}; do docker run --name spider$i --network=spider_farm_net -d spiderpool:latest & done
上述命令会启动10个爬虫容器,每个容器在独立的网络环境中运行,可以根据需要调整容器数量和配置。
管理爬虫容器
使用docker ps
查看运行的容器,使用docker logs <container_id>
查看某个容器的日志输出,如果需要停止或删除容器,可以使用以下命令:
# 删除所有爬虫容器 docker rm $(docker ps -q)
图解视频教程(示例)
以下是一个简单的图解视频教程示例,展示如何按照上述步骤搭建蜘蛛池:
- 准备环境:展示如何安装操作系统和必要的软件。
- 安装Docker:通过动画或截图展示在Ubuntu和CentOS上安装Docker的步骤。
- 创建Docker网络:通过命令行输出展示创建网络的过程。
- 下载并配置Spider Pool镜像:展示从Docker Hub下载镜像的过程。
- 启动爬虫容器:通过动画或截图展示启动多个爬虫容器的命令和结果。
- 管理爬虫容器:展示如何查看、停止和删除容器的操作。
- 总结与提示:总结搭建蜘蛛池的关键步骤和注意事项。
(注:实际视频教程应包含动态演示和详细解说,此处仅提供文字描述。)
实际应用与优化建议
- 扩展性:根据需要增加或减少爬虫容器数量,以应对不同规模的网站分析需求,可以通过编写脚本实现自动化管理,2. 安全性:确保爬虫行为符合搜索引擎的服务条款和条件,避免对目标网站造成负担或被封禁,3. 性能优化:根据服务器资源情况调整容器配置,如内存、CPU等,以提高爬虫效率,4. 数据收集与分析:收集并分析爬虫数据,识别网站结构、内容质量、链接关系等关键信息,为SEO优化提供决策支持,5. 持续监控与改进:定期监控爬虫性能和效果,根据反馈调整策略和优化配置,通过搭建蜘蛛池并合理利用其收集的数据信息,可以显著提升网站在搜索引擎中的排名和可见度,希望本文提供的教程和视频示例能帮助读者成功搭建并有效运用蜘蛛池工具进行SEO分析和优化工作。
发布于:2025-06-09,除非注明,否则均为
原创文章,转载请注明出处。